Shapiro, Arato & Isserles Wins Second Circuit Ruling Granting Bail Pending Appeal in Tax And Wire Fraud Case
On May 7, 2014, the United States Court of Appeals for the Second Circuit granted the motion of our client, a 65-year-old widow, and her co-defendant, for release on bail pending our appeal of her criminal conviction.
